Tire Requirements and Markings
Recognizing the markings on your tires can be a game-changer. These markings offer vital details concerning the tire's size, lots capability, and speed rating. For example, a tire marked "P215/65R15 95H" tells you its size, element ratio, diameter, load index, and rate rating.
The Function of Tire Pressure
Significance of Appropriate Tire Stress
Maintaining the proper tire stress is crucial for safety and efficiency. Under-inflated tires can cause bad handling, boosted wear, and higher gas usage. Over-inflated tires, on the other hand, can reduce traction and trigger irregular wear.
Just How to Inspect Tire Stress
To inspect your tire pressure, you'll need a trusted tire gauge. Right here's a easy step-by-step:
1. ** Locate the Recommended Stress: ** Look for the manufacturer's recommended pressure, normally discovered on a sticker label inside the driver's door or in the owner's manual.
2. ** Inspect When Cold: ** Procedure tire pressure when the tires are chilly for an accurate reading.
3. ** Utilize a Tire Scale: ** Eliminate the valve cap, press the gauge onto the shutoff stem, and keep in mind the analysis.
4. ** Readjust as Needed: ** Inflate or deflate your tires to match the suggested stress.
Recommended Tire Pressure Degrees
Most automobile advise a tire pressure in between 30-35 PSI. However, always describe your car's particular guidelines.
Tire Footstep Depth and Safety And Security
What is Tire Footstep Deepness?
Step depth refers to the vertical measurement between the top of the step rubber to the bottom of the tire's inmost grooves. It's important for keeping traction, particularly in wet conditions.
How to Gauge Tire Step Depth
You can determine tread depth utilizing a walk deepness gauge or the penny test. Put a dime right into the step groove with Lincoln's head facing down. If you can see the top of Lincoln's head, it's time to replace your tires.
Minimum Tread Depth Requirements
Many specialists advise changing tires when the step deepness drops listed below 2/32 of an inch. For winter season tires, it's ideal to change them at 4/32 of an inch to make sure sufficient grip on snow and ice.
The Importance of Tire Turning
Advantages of Normal Tire Turning
Revolving your tires makes certain also use and expands their lifespan. It likewise enhances efficiency and security by preserving well balanced grip and handling.
How Frequently to Revolve Tires
Normally, you should rotate your t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les. Nonetheless, consult your lorry's handbook for specific referrals.

Wheel Positioning and Harmonizing
Difference Between Alignment and Harmonizing
Wheel placement entails adjusting the angles of the wheels to the manufacturer's requirements, guaranteeing they are identical and correctly oriented. Harmonizing, on the other hand, fixes the distribution of weight around the tire and wheel assembly.
Indications Your Wheels Demand Alignment
Usual signs consist of unequal tire wear, the car pulling to one side, and a jagged steering wheel when driving directly.
Importance of Wheel Balancing
Unbalanced wheels can trigger resonances, uneven tire wear, and stress on your lorry's suspension. Routine harmonizing guarantees a smooth experience and lengthens tire life.
Finding Tire Damages and Wear
Typical Types of Tire Damage
- ** Punctures: ** Tiny holes triggered by sharp things.
- ** Cracks: ** Age-related or due to direct exposure to rough conditions.
- ** Bulges: ** Usually caused by influence damage.
How to Evaluate Tires for Wear and Damages
Routinely inspect your tires for indicators of damages, such as cuts, cracks, or bulges. Likewise, try to find uneven wear patterns, which can indicate positioning or suspension concerns.
When to Change Your Tires
Replace your tires if they show indications of considerable damages, have a step depth below 2/32 of an inch, or are over 6 years of ages, regardless of walk wear.
Seasonal Tire Upkeep
Summer vs. Winter months Tires
Summertime tires offer ideal efficiency in cozy problems however lack the traction needed for cool and snowy weather. Winter season tires, with their much deeper footsteps and softer rubber, are designed for icy and snowy roads.
When to Modification Your Tires
Switch over to winter tires when temperatures regularly drop below 45 ° F (7 ° C) and back to summertime or all-season tires when temperature levels rise above this degree.
Keeping Off-Season Tires
Shop tires in a cool, completely dry area, far from direct sunlight. Keep them in impermeable bags to shield them from ozone and temperature level changes.
